      <study_design>Randomization: Randomized, Blinding: Double blinded, Placebo: Not used, Assignment: Other, Purpose: Supportive, Other design features: Two groups were randomly selected: the experimental group and the control group, Randomization description: The randomization method is simple, it is an individual randomization unit using statistical software, Blinding description: Assessors and patients are blinded to the scenarios and assignments.</study_design>
      <phase>N/A</phase>
      <hc_freetext>Cognitive motor rehabilitation of stroke patients.</hc_freetext>
      <i_freetext>Intervention 1: Intervention group: 10 people in the experimental group (i.e. standard medical care plus playing a serious game), eight weeks of intervention including 16 sessions, each session lasting 30 minutes. Intervention 2: Control group: 10 people in the control group who only receive standard medical care in eight weeks of intervention including 16 sessions, each session lasting 30 minutes.</i_freetext>
